How Do I Remove My Waistband?

Remove the waistbands A craft knife makes quick work of waistband removal. Use its blade to slice through the stitches at the waistband seam. If using a sharp craft knife makes you nervous, you may be able to remove the stitches quickly if the seam has been sewn with a chainstitch.

Taking In a Waistband

  1. Use the seam ripper to remove the waistband to just past the side seam on each side.
  2. Pin the side seams to take up any excess fabric in the body of the garment.
  3. Use a fabric pencil to mark where you would like the waistband to end.
  4. Remove any buttons or other closures currently on the waistband.

How do you take out a skirt waistband?

To do this, poke the blade of the seam ripper into the stitches where the waistband is sewn to the skirt. Cut through a few stitches at a time, taking care not to cut the fabric. When you’ve cut through the stitches, gently tug the waistband away from the skirt, and pull away the loose threads.

How do you loosen a tight waistband?

First, pull the elastic band to the maximum, and then put it on the ironing board or a wider wooden board. Then use an electric iron to iron back and forth on the elastic band. After a few minutes of ironing, the elastic will become slightly looser.

How do you take in an elastic waistband?

  1. Use a seam ripper to take out 3 inches of the casing seam.
  2. Pull out the elastic and pin a 1-inch loop in it to tighten it.
  3. Try on the garment to check the fit and change the size of the loop until you are pleased with the fit.
  4. Cut the elastic and overlap it, keeping the pin in the same place.

How can I permanently stretch elastic?

Iron the elastic while pulling and stretching it. The heat from the iron will break down the elasticity of the material and create a permanent stretch of the elastic.
